    .348 owners

    Lyman 44th page 86 .348 Winchester w/ 220 grain Jacketed: IMR-4895 start = 47.0, max = 52.0 IMR-4350 start = 54.0, max = 60.0

    Tough Bullet Opinions - Large Game

    jim, The Swift-As are similar to the partition in that both have the "partition" The SAs just have the "partition" farther forward. Thus they don't expand quite as fast and as wide. But they hold the "mushroom" shape and don't lose very much weight; they retain +90% verses about 70% for the...
